The Role of Farmers in Society

Farmers play a vital role in society by ensuring a stable food supply. They work tirelessly to grow crops, raise animals, and manage their land, often in harsh conditions. Their dedication and hard work enable us to have access to a diverse range of food products, from fruits and vegetables to grains and dairy.

Moreover, farmers contribute to the environment by maintaining the balance of ecosystems and preserving natural resources. Sustainable farming practices, such as crop rotation and organic farming, help protect the soil, water, and air quality, ensuring that future generations will have access to healthy food sources.

Challenges Facing Farmers

Despite the essential role farmers play, they often face numerous challenges. One of the most significant challenges is the fluctuating prices of agricultural products, which can be affected by factors such as climate change, market demand, and political instability. This volatility can lead to financial difficulties for farmers, as they struggle to cover their expenses and maintain their livelihoods.

Additionally, farmers must deal with the pressures of land degradation, water scarcity, and pests and diseases that threaten their crops and livestock. These challenges can lead to decreased yields, increased production costs, and, in some cases, complete crop failure.

Technological Advancements in Farming

To overcome these challenges, farmers are increasingly turning to technology to improve their farming practices. Innovations such as precision agriculture, genetically modified organisms (GMOs), and drones are revolutionizing the way food is produced. These technologies can help farmers increase yields, reduce waste, and make more informed decisions about their crops and livestock.

Precision agriculture, for example, uses satellite imagery, GPS, and sensors to monitor crop health and soil conditions, allowing farmers to apply fertilizers and water more efficiently. Drones can be used for crop monitoring, spraying pesticides, and even harvesting, reducing labor costs and improving efficiency.
